The stunning beauty of the New Mexico landscape has inspired many, as can be seen by the number of artists and artist communities that are located throughout the state. With such remarkable spots as White Sands and Carlsbad Caverns alongside the history of many different cultures–including those of Mexico and many Native American tribes, New Mexico has a flavor all its own.

The economy in New Mexico is also driven by a diverse set of factors. Agriculture, particularly livestock, plays an important role, as does mining of potassium, uranium, copper, gold, silver, zinc, natural gas, and petroleum. Another important element of the economic picture is the large amount of scientific research and development for nuclear, solar, and geothermal energy. According to New Mexico Department of Workforce Solutions, some of the fastest growing jobs in the future economy of New Mexico will require at least a Bachelor’s degree. These jobs include computer software engineers, industrial engineers, social workers, teachers, pharmacists, and registered nurses.

Getting a degree to ensure a successful career in New Mexico can be done through the Christian universities and Bible colleges in the state. These schools offer a variety of options for students. Some schools, such as The University of New Mexico, offer the benefits of a larger university along with the specialized focus of a Christian curriculum available through their Religious Studies Program. The Albuquerque campus of Wayland Baptist University is another school that offers traditional degrees alongside religious studies. Other schools offer less traditional options when it comes to general studies, but provide a very focused examination of theology. Nazarene Bible College is a good examples of these types of schools.
